New Ford Figo to launch on September 23, 2015
The new Figo hatchback will be powered by 1.2-litre petrol and 1.5-litre diesel engines.

Ford has announced that it will be launching the new Figo on September 23. The new Figo hatchback will be manufactured alongside the Figo Aspire at the company's Sanand plant in Gujarat.
Based on the same platform as the Figo Aspire, the new Figo will sport a styling and silhouette similar to its compact sedan sibling up to the rear wheels, from where the boot of sedan makes way for a hatch flanked by wrap-around tail-lamps. Inside, the new Figo will get the same dashboard as the Aspire, although here Ford might give the dual-tone treatment a miss. Features are also expected to remain identical between the two models.
Mechanically, the new Ford Figo hatchback gets the choice of a 1.2-litre petrol or a 1.5-litre diesel engine mated to a five-speed manual gearbox as standard.
